Frank K. Chevallier Boutell (1899-1974) was an Argentine lawyer,[1] and sportsman. He was player and vice president of the Club Universitario de Buenos Aires.[2]

Personal life

Club Universitario de Buenos Aires team of 1931.

He was born in Quilmes, son of Arthur Brandon Chevallier Boutell, born in England, and María Josefina García Osorio, belonging to an ancient family of Creole roots.[3] He was graduated as a lawyer at the University of Buenos Aires.[4]

Frank K. Chevallier Boutell was married with Raquel Benegas Lynch, a distinguished lady descendant of Justo Pastor Lynch and Miguel de Riglos Bástida.[5]

Sport career

Chevallier Boutell began his career playing in the Buenos Aires F.C., then he played in Universitario, team where he won the URBA championship of 1931. He was the vice-president of Universitario and of the Argentine Rugby Union in 1949–1950.[6] Chevallier Boutell served also as honorary secretary of the same institution in 1932.[7]
